Transaction 05816650427d08da74fe6ca0cec75ad9fe960f37ea1aed6bd389971bce51be10

1 Input
2 Outputs
  • 05816650427d08da74fe6ca0cec75ad9fe960f37ea1aed6bd389971bce51be10:0
  • value  20000
    address  2MvcwCTS5zSTf2fuUydxG7Wn6HfH3MRkYtq
  • 05816650427d08da74fe6ca0cec75ad9fe960f37ea1aed6bd389971bce51be10:1
  • value  28695230
    address  mwCMcEFUwXHpt4gLTB2wUhbP5c4M3HS9Un